Yes that is correct...

Cannavaro is not part of new Real Madrid boss Bernd Schuster’s plans. Coach Schuster does not want to keep hold of him after signing Christoph Metzelder from Borussia Dortmund and £19m-rated Pepe from Porto.

Newcastle United and Chelsea have made inqiuries after the 33-year-old defender, but he said he would prefer a return to Italy

Juve are the most likely club he will go to, though Chelsea and Newcastle are very very interested
